本出願は、図1に示すような粘弾性形状記憶発泡体(以下単に「粘弾性発泡体」という)を備えて構成されたパッド(トレンデレンブルグ・パッド)を用いて、傾斜させた支持台上でトレンデレンブルグ体位等の所望の体位に患者を保持することを支援すると共に、支持台上での患者のスライド、ずれ、又は同様の望ましくない動きを最小限に抑えることを支援することを開示する。このような動きは患者に行われている医療処置を妨害する恐れがある。また、粘弾性発泡体は患者の緩衝及び支持を行いつつ、患者の身体全体への圧力の分散を促進することで、圧力の集中による神経及び/又は組織に対する損傷を軽減及び/又は最小限に抑える。例えば粘弾性発泡体は、患者の首、腕、及び/又は肩に対する圧力を最小限に抑えることで、腕及び肩における痛み、運動低下、又は感覚低下を含む上腕神経叢障害を最小限に抑えるか又は排除することができ、これによって神経イベントを最小限に抑えるか又は軽減する。少なくとも1つの可能な実施形態において、粘弾性発泡体は、前述の所望の効果を促進するように選択された特徴を有する。これについては以下の段落で論じる。以下の段落で論じる特徴は全て少なくとも1つの可能な実施形態に従ったものであり、少なくとも1つの可能な実施形態に従ってこれらの特徴のいずれか1つ以上を、これらの特徴のいずれか1つ以上と組み合わせることができ、以下の段落で開示するいかなる範囲も、特定の範囲の10分の1及び100分の1の単位を含むいずれかの値を含むものとして理解される。 This application uses the pad (Trendelenburg pad) configured such viscoelastic shape memory foam (hereinafter simply referred to as "viscoelastic foam") comprises a 1, a support which is inclined To help keep the patient in a desired position, such as the Trendelenburg position, and to help minimize the patient's sliding, shifting, or similar undesirable movement on the support platform. Disclose. Such movement can interfere with medical procedures being performed on the patient. The viscoelastic foam also cushions and supports the patient while facilitating the distribution of pressure throughout the patient's body to reduce and / or minimize damage to nerves and / or tissues due to pressure concentration. suppress. For example, viscoelastic foam minimizes brachial plexus disorders, including pain, hypokinesia, or hyposensory in the arms and shoulders by minimizing pressure on the patient's neck, arms, and / or shoulders Or can be eliminated, thereby minimizing or reducing neural events. 図1に示すように、外科患者支持パッドとしてのトレンデレンブルグ・パッド102は、このトレンデレンブルグ・パッド102の長手方向の側面の外側に延出するファスナ104を備えることができる。ファスナ104の各端部は、Velcro(登録商標)ファスナ等のフック及びループを備えることができ、これは、患者が位置付けられる支持構造に応じて、トレンデレンブルグ・パッド102を手術台のレール又は他の隣接構造に取り付けるように構成及び配置されている。支持構造は手術ベッドである場合もそうでない場合もある。例えばファスナ104の各端部は、ループ部108及びこのループ部108の外側に延出するフック部106を備えることができる。更に、トレンデレンブルグ・パッド102の外側に延出するファスナ104の1つ以上の部分はラベル110を備えることができ、これはトレンデレンブルグ・パッド102の手術台に対する向きを示す。例えばラベル110には「この面を上にする」と記すことができる。 As shown in FIG. 1, a Trendelenburg pad 102 as a surgical patient support pad can include a fastener 104 that extends outside the longitudinal side of the Trendelenburg pad 102. Each end of the fastener 104 may include hooks and loops, such as Velcro® fasteners, that allow the Trendelenburg pad 102 to be attached to the operating table rail or to the support structure on which the patient is positioned. Configured and arranged to attach to other adjacent structures. The support structure may or may not be a surgical bed. For example, each end of the fastener 104 can include a loop portion 108 and a hook portion 106 that extends outside the loop portion 108. Further, one or more portions of fastener 104 that extend outside Trendelenburg pad 102 may include a label 110 that indicates the orientation of Trendelenburg pad 102 with respect to the operating table. For example, the label 110 can be marked "This side up".
